## Service Accounts — Config Hot-Reload

The Emberline config service watches the `reload` channel and swaps configs without restarts. Each consumer runs under its own service account; do not share accounts across environments. Reload events are signed by the Thornquist signer. If signature checks fail, the old config stays active. The watcher authenticates to Emberline with the account's key, listed below.

gateway credential: kto23_LX9A4ys6i4nzHtpOLNLodKK

**Mgmt Meeting Minutes — Retiring the Brightline Range**

Quick recap for sales leads at Fenholt Supplies: we agreed to retire the Brightline fixture range by year-end. Remaining stock moves to clearance pricing next month, and accounts on standing orders get migrated to the Lumetta range. Trade-in incentives were approved in principle. The confidential note on next steps sits just below.

board note of bajof-bajeg: The pricing group signed off on a budget of $13.4 million for Project Sildor. The renewal with Lamixek Holdings closes at $48.9 million a year, 49 percent above the last contract.

Handover note for branch managers, from Director Alys Fenmore to Director Rowan Teske. We have been evaluating a possible acquisition of Quillbrook Logistics for several months. Due diligence on their fleet, contracts, and regional depots is substantially complete, and valuation discussions continue under strict confidentiality. Please maintain normal operations and refer any inquiries upward without comment. A restricted note on our plans follows immediately below.

confidential, fahag-yahap: Project Raleth slips by six weeks because of the tooling delay.

**Ceremony item 4 — BounceBroker credential reseal.** Support team: the bounce processor's inbox poller uses a sealed credential bundle rotated at each ceremony. Confirm the old bundle is revoked, verify the suppression-list export completed, and check that hard bounces queued during the freeze are replayed afterward. Do not reopen tickets about delayed bounce notices until replay finishes. If the sealed bundle must be opened outside a scheduled ceremony, authorized staff unlock it using the recovery passphrase printed on the following line.

strongbox words: zorwyn-sorael-belion-ulaius-silmir-ulays-briax-rusdor-gorix